Historically the Katana was one of the traditionally manufactured Japanese swords used by the Samurai of feudal Japan.
The first use of the word "katana" as a term for a longsword, which was different from a tachi, dates back to the Kamakura period (1185-1333). The katana was often paired with a similar smaller accompanying sword, such as a wakizashi, or it could also be carried with the tanto, a smaller, similarly shaped dagger. The mating of a katana with a smaller sword is called Daisho. Only samurai could wear the Daisho: it represented diesocial power and the personal honour of the samurai.
The katana is characterized by its distinctive appearance: a curved, slender, single-edged blade with a circular guard and a long handle for two hands. It has been historically associated with the samurai of feudal Japan.
